Output db55bd2672851a15e5b186acb013b88048978c31a98e2857190d2ffddf12d890:0

value
4038009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 222bfa8a274ba7ae63dd90e32c070feb30da5fb0 OP_EQUAL
address
34ohaktnBz8JhvPkP8Es36eLXiDh2dqWgf
transaction
db55bd2672851a15e5b186acb013b88048978c31a98e2857190d2ffddf12d890
spent
true